Ncikpage

Du hast Probleme beim Einbau oder bei der Benutzung eines Mods? In diesem Forum bist du richtig.
Forumsregeln
phpBB 2.0 hat das Ende seiner Lebenszeit überschritten
phpBB 2.0 wird nicht mehr aktiv unterstützt. Insbesondere werden - auch bei Sicherheitslücken - keine Patches mehr bereitgestellt. Der Einsatz von phpBB 2.0 erfolgt daher auf eigene Gefahr. Wir empfehlen einen Umstieg auf phpBB 3.0, welches aktiv weiterentwickelt wird und für welches regelmäßig Updates zur Verfügung gestellt werden.
Benutzeravatar
Baby Crash
Mitglied
Beiträge: 68
Registriert: 08.06.2005 21:33
Wohnort: Köln
Kontaktdaten:

Beitrag von Baby Crash »

Das werden wir gleich sehen. Ich lade grade die geänderten templates hoch. Dann wird es sich zeigen, ob es geht oder nicht!
Hoffe, diesmal klappt es!
Benutzeravatar
Baby Crash
Mitglied
Beiträge: 68
Registriert: 08.06.2005 21:33
Wohnort: Köln
Kontaktdaten:

Beitrag von Baby Crash »

Also, ich bekomme folgende Fehlrmeldung:

Ein Forum nur für Freunde Foren-Übersicht
Allgemeiner Fehler

Konnte Querrie nicht ausführen!

DEBUG MODE

SQL Error : 1146 Table 'sesamstreet.phpbbtest2_nickpagemod' doesn't exist

SELECT COUNT(uid) AS zaehle FROM phpbbtest2_nickpagemod WHERE uid='2'

Line : 510
File : page_header.php





Administrations-Bereich


Powered by phpBB © 2001, 2005 phpBB Group
Deutsche Übersetzung von phpBB.de

Ich lese daaus, das da was mit der db nicht stimmt. Bei anderen mods war da immer eine selbstinstallation, die die Datenbank selbst änderte. Nur leider hier nicht! Gibts so was??

Baby Crash
Benutzeravatar
Markus67
Ehrenadmin
Beiträge: 28346
Registriert: 12.01.2004 16:02
Wohnort: Neuss
Kontaktdaten:

Beitrag von Markus67 »

Hi ...

die nickpage_install.php in den Forumroot hochladen (da wo auch memberlist.php ist) und dann im Browser aufrufen :wink:

Markus
Benutzeravatar
Baby Crash
Mitglied
Beiträge: 68
Registriert: 08.06.2005 21:33
Wohnort: Köln
Kontaktdaten:

Beitrag von Baby Crash »

ja, das hab ich ja gemacht, aber wenn ich dann da eingebe:

http://sesamstreet.se.funpic.de/phpBB2- ... nstall.php

dann steht da:

Sie sind nicht befugt, den Mod zu installieren!

Bitte wenden Sie sich an Ihren Boardadministrator.

Dan logge ich mich ein und dann kommt dieser Fehler halt! Ich hab das schon zig oft probiert und es tut sich gar nichts!
Hochgeladen hab ichs!

Ich habe Intro+Portalmod, Usercars, Mitarbeiter, admin reminder mod installiert!
Beim admin reminder ist auch ein bug, der aber meines erachtens nicht schwerwiegen ist, weil das Forum funktioniert!

Was kann ich machen? Ich habs aufjedenfall hochgeladen!
Benutzeravatar
Markus67
Ehrenadmin
Beiträge: 28346
Registriert: 12.01.2004 16:02
Wohnort: Neuss
Kontaktdaten:

Beitrag von Markus67 »

Hi ...

nicht schön ... aber dürfte funktionieren ...

öffne die nickpage_install.php

suche und lösche:

Code: Alles auswählen

if($userdata['user_level'] == ADMIN)
{
suche und lösche:

Code: Alles auswählen

}
else
{
	message_die(GENERAL_MESSAGE,'Sie sind nicht befugt, den Mod zu installieren!<br>
	<br>
	Bitte wenden Sie sich an Ihren Boardadministrator.');
}
Und dann das ganze nochmal hochladen und aufrufen.

Markus
Benutzeravatar
Baby Crash
Mitglied
Beiträge: 68
Registriert: 08.06.2005 21:33
Wohnort: Köln
Kontaktdaten:

Beitrag von Baby Crash »

Ich habs gemacht und hochgeladen. Jetzt kommt es zu dieser Fehlrmeldung:

Parse error: parse error, unexpected $ in /usr/export/www/vhosts/funnetwork/hosting/sesamstreet/phpBB2-2.0.15-deutsch2/phpBB2/nickpage_install.php on line 135
Benutzeravatar
Markus67
Ehrenadmin
Beiträge: 28346
Registriert: 12.01.2004 16:02
Wohnort: Neuss
Kontaktdaten:

Beitrag von Markus67 »

Hi ...

das sollte das Ende der Datei sein ...

Code: Alles auswählen

	//$table_name[] = $table_prefix."nickpagevotes";
	$sql[] = "CREATE TABLE IF NOT EXISTS ".$table_prefix."nickpagevotes (
	  uid int(6) NOT NULL default '0',
	  von int(6) NOT NULL default '0',
	  vote tinyint(1) NOT NULL default '0'
	)";
	for($x=0;$x<count($sql);$x++)
	{
		$db->sql_query($sql[$x]);
	}
	message_die(GENERAL_MESSAGE,'Installation abgeschlossen.<br>
	<br>
	Unter Umständen ist es erforderlich die Nickpage über das ACP zu konfigurieren.<br>
	<br>
	Viel Spass...');

include($phpbb_root_path . 'includes/page_tail.'.$phpEx);
?>
und nach ?> keine Leerzeilen mehr.

Markus
Benutzeravatar
Baby Crash
Mitglied
Beiträge: 68
Registriert: 08.06.2005 21:33
Wohnort: Köln
Kontaktdaten:

Beitrag von Baby Crash »

Das wäre wunderbar, aber leider geht es immer noch nicht!
Mein Code:

Code: Alles auswählen

<?
define('IN_PHPBB', true);
$phpbb_root_path = './';
include($phpbb_root_path . 'extension.inc');
include($phpbb_root_path . 'common.'.$phpEx);

//
// Start session management
//
$userdata = session_pagestart($user_ip, PAGE_INDEX);
init_userprefs($userdata);
//
// End session management
//
include($phpbb_root_path . 'includes/page_header.'.$phpEx);


{
	unset($sql);
	#
	# Tabellenstruktur für Tabelle `nickpagebuddies`
	#
	//$table_name[] = $table_prefix."nickpagebuddies";
	$sql[] = "CREATE TABLE IF NOT EXISTS ".$table_prefix."nickpagebuddies (
	  uid mediumint(8) NOT NULL default '0',
	  buddie mediumint(8) NOT NULL default '0'
	)";
	# --------------------------------------------------------

	#
	# Tabellenstruktur für Tabelle `nickpageconf`
	#
	//$table_name[] = $table_prefix."nickpageconf";
	$sql[] = "CREATE TABLE IF NOT EXISTS ".$table_prefix."nickpageconf (
		registered_only tinyint(1) NOT NULL default '0',
		anzahl_posts int(8) NOT NULL default '0',
		buddielist int(8) NOT NULL default '0',
		favlinks int(8) NOT NULL default '0',
		allow_guestbook tinyint(1) NOT NULL default '0',
		guestbook_writer tinyint(1) NOT NULL default '0',
		entry_per_page mediumint(5) NOT NULL default '0',
		allow_galerie tinyint(1) NOT NULL default '0',
		galery_maxpics int(8) NOT NULL default '0',
		allow_kreatives tinyint(1) NOT NULL default '0',
		gd tinyint(1) NOT NULL default '0'
	)";
	//Datensatz einfügen
	$sql[] = "INSERT INTO ".$table_prefix."nickpageconf VALUES (0, 0, 10, 10, 1, 0, 10, 1, 25, 1, 2 )";
	# --------------------------------------------------------

	#
	# Tabellenstruktur für Tabelle `nickpagefavs`
	#
	//$table_name[] = $table_prefix."nickpagefavs";
	$sql[] = "CREATE TABLE IF NOT EXISTS ".$table_prefix."nickpagefavs (
	  uid mediumint(8) NOT NULL default '0',
	  url varchar(100) NOT NULL default '',
	  urlname varchar(100) NOT NULL default ''
	)";
	# --------------------------------------------------------

	#
	# Tabellenstruktur für Tabelle `nickpagegalerie`
	#
	//$table_name[] = $table_prefix."nickpagegalerie";
	$sql[] = "CREATE TABLE IF NOT EXISTS ".$table_prefix."nickpagegalerie (
	  gal_id int(5) NOT NULL auto_increment,
	  uid int(5) NOT NULL default '0',
	  pic varchar(100) NOT NULL default '',
	  comment varchar(100) NOT NULL default '',
	  PRIMARY KEY  (gal_id)
	)";
	# --------------------------------------------------------

	#
	# Tabellenstruktur für Tabelle `nickpagegb`
	#
	//$table_name[] = $table_prefix."nickpagegb";
	$sql[] = "CREATE TABLE IF NOT EXISTS ".$table_prefix."nickpagegb (
	  aid int(10) NOT NULL auto_increment,
	  von mediumint(8) NOT NULL default '0',
	  autor varchar(100) NOT NULL default '',
	  an mediumint(8) NOT NULL default '0',
	  zeit varchar(40) NOT NULL default '',
	  message varchar(255) NOT NULL default '',
	  PRIMARY KEY  (aid)
	)";
	# --------------------------------------------------------

	#
	# Tabellenstruktur für Tabelle `nickpagemod`
	#
	//$table_name[] = $table_prefix."nickpagemod";
	$sql[] = "CREATE TABLE IF NOT EXISTS ".$table_prefix."nickpagemod (
	  uid mediumint(8) NOT NULL default '0',
	  name varchar(25) NOT NULL default '',
	  born varchar(40) NOT NULL default '',
	  pic varchar(255) NOT NULL default '',
	  specialnick varchar(255) NOT NULL default '',
	  info varchar(255) NOT NULL default '',
	  visits mediumint(8) NOT NULL default '0',
	  vote int(8) NOT NULL default '0',
	  votes int(5) NOT NULL default '0',
	  kreatives text NOT NULL,
	  safe tinyint(1) NOT NULL default '0',
	  safe_gb tinyint(1) NOT NULL default '0',
	  gb_email tinyint(1) NOT NULL default '0',
	  status tinyint(4) NOT NULL default '0',
  	  PRIMARY KEY (uid)
	)";
	# --------------------------------------------------------

	#
	# Tabellenstruktur für Tabelle `nickpagevotes`
	#
        //$table_name[] = $table_prefix."nickpagevotes";
   $sql[] = "CREATE TABLE IF NOT EXISTS ".$table_prefix."nickpagevotes (
     uid int(6) NOT NULL default '0',
     von int(6) NOT NULL default '0',
     vote tinyint(1) NOT NULL default '0'
   )";
   for($x=0;$x<count($sql);$x++)
   {
      $db->sql_query($sql[$x]);
   }
   message_die(GENERAL_MESSAGE,'Installation abgeschlossen.<br>
   <br>
   Unter Umständen ist es erforderlich die Nickpage über das ACP zu konfigurieren.<br>
   <br>
   Viel Spass...');

include($phpbb_root_path . 'includes/page_tail.'.$phpEx);
?>
Die Fehleranzeige:

Parse error: parse error, unexpected $ in /usr/export/www/vhosts/funnetwork/hosting/sesamstreet/phpBB2-2.0.15-deutsch2/phpBB2/nickpage_install.php on line 133

Ich hab nachgeschaut auf lerrzeichen, sind aber keine Vorhanden! Ich kann mir das nicht erklären!
Benutzeravatar
Markus67
Ehrenadmin
Beiträge: 28346
Registriert: 12.01.2004 16:02
Wohnort: Neuss
Kontaktdaten:

Beitrag von Markus67 »

Hi ...

suche:

Code: Alles auswählen

include($phpbb_root_path . 'includes/page_header.'.$phpEx); 


{ 
Die geschweifte Klammer muss noch weg :wink:

Markus
Benutzeravatar
Baby Crash
Mitglied
Beiträge: 68
Registriert: 08.06.2005 21:33
Wohnort: Köln
Kontaktdaten:

Beitrag von Baby Crash »

Hat geklappt. Vielen Vielen Dank an dich! Du hast mir sehr geholfen! ;)
Antworten

Zurück zu „phpBB 2.0: Mod Support“